Spirit Airlines, a staple for budget travelers flying in and out of Harry Reid International Airport, prepared to halt operations as early as 3 a.m. Eastern Time on Saturday after negotiations for a $500 million government rescue collapsed.[1][2] The failure stranded passengers across routes, including those bound for Las Vegas, amid the carrier’s ongoing bankruptcy proceedings. Bondholders rejected the deal terms, which would have given the government potential control of up to 90 percent of the company.[3]
Collapse of the Government Lifeline
The Trump administration pursued a bailout package worth $500 million in loans and funding, but opposition from key Spirit bondholders derailed the effort. These investors argued the terms would diminish their recovery prospects in a potential failure scenario. Internal divisions within the administration, including concerns over taxpayer funds, further stalled progress.[1]
President Donald Trump addressed the impasse directly. “We’re looking at Spirit and we’ll help them if we can, but we have to come first. America comes first,” he told reporters on Friday.[2] Spirit CEO Dave Davis expressed gratitude for the administration’s involvement earlier in the process, noting the need to protect jobs and affordable fares.
